NAGATA, Kiyo Mary (Kay) (nee Sumi)  - Passed away peacefully, on November 28, 2017.

Born on Mayne Island, BC, Kay attended high school in Vancouver and married Ken on Mayne Island in 1938.

Kay is survived by son Allan (Linda) of London, son-in-law Ian McMillan of Guelph, grandsons John of Burlington and Robert (Kennah) of Guelph and great-grandchildren Caleigh and James.

She will be sadly missed by many nieces, nephews, extended family and friends.

Predeceased by husband Ken in 2003 and daughter Carolyn McMillan in 2008. Kay had a passion for flowers, travel, and gatherings with friends and family. Kay and Ken were longtime members of the Toronto Garden Club, the Toronto Japanese Garden Club and St. Andrew's Japanese Congregation. Cremation has taken place.

The family will host a memorial at a later date.

In lieu of flowers and koden, please consider donations to the Heart & Stroke Foundation or charity of choice.
